Barack Obama Quotes

The Profound Mistake Of Reverend Wright's Sermons Is Not That He Spoke About Racism In Our Society. It's That He Spoke As If Our Society Was Static; As If No Progress Has Been Made; As If This Country - A Country That Has Made It Possible For One Of His Own Members To Run For The Highest Office In The Land And Build A Coalition Of White And Black; Latino And Asian, Rich And Poor, Young And Old - Is Still Irrevocably Bound To A Tragic Past.
